2005 Fiat Ulysse vs. 1963 Fiat Cabriolet

To start off, 2005 Fiat Ulysse is newer by 42 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1963 Fiat Cabriolet.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1963 Fiat Cabriolet would be higher. At 2,179 cc (4 cylinders), 2005 Fiat Ulysse is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Fiat Ulysse (126 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 64 more horse power than 1963 Fiat Cabriolet. (62 HP @ 5300 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Fiat Ulysse should accelerate faster than 1963 Fiat Cabriolet.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Fiat Ulysse weights approximately 893 kg more than 1963 Fiat Cabriolet.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1963 Fiat Cabriolet is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1963 Fiat Cabriolet.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Fiat Ulysse,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Fiat Ulysse (305 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 210 more torque (in Nm) than 1963 Fiat Cabriolet. (95 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2005 Fiat Ulysse will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1963 Fiat Cabriolet.

Compare all specifications:

2005 Fiat Ulysse 1963 Fiat Cabriolet
Make Fiat Fiat
Model Ulysse Cabriolet
Year Released 2005 1963
Body Type Minivan Convertible
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2179 cc 1221 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 126 HP 62 HP
Engine RPM 4000 RPM 5300 RPM
Torque 305 Nm 95 Nm
Torque RPM 2000 RPM 4000 RPM
Fuel Type Diesel Gasoline
Drive Type Front Rear
Number of Doors 5 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 1783 kg 890 kg
Vehicle Length 4730 mm 4040 mm
Vehicle Width 1870 mm 1530 mm
Vehicle Height 1760 mm 1310 mm
Wheelbase Size 2830 mm 2350 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 80 L 37 L
